Many people have different definitions of what Mythology really is
'Mythology is known as the body of myths of a particular culture, and the study and interpretation of those myths
Myth may be broadly defined as a narrative, that through many retellings, has become an accepted tradition in a society
(1)' If this is the true definition of mythology, why then do not some our stories from today fit into this category
You do not hear people talking about the american Mythology, excluding of course the Native americans which have a very wide spectrum of tales
Myths typically occur in every culture all around the world
Myths dealt with various aspects of a culture, some were meant to simply tell a story, most had a deeper meaning hidden within the tale for the listener/reader to consider
There are scholars who believe that because these myths typically involved gods and supreme beings, that it was a dimension of a religion

Myths are made for the imagination to breathe life into them
As for this myth, one sees merely the whole effort of a body straining to raise the huge stone, to roll it, and push it up a slope a hundred times over; one sees the face screw ed up, the cheek tight against the stone, the shoulder bracing the clay-covered mass, the foot wedging it, the fresh start with arms outstretched, the wholly human security of two earth-clotted hands
If this myth is tragic, that is because its hero is conscious
